Closing movement with interrupted protective field
The AKAS® system offers the possibility to execute a closing movement under monitored slow speed even when
the protective field is interrupted.
After the interruption of the protecfive field and the release and reactivation of the foot pedal, the AKAS will deac-
tivate the SGA output when the protective field is interrupted. By this, only slow speed will be enabled by the ma-
chine control (NC).
AKAS® provides a reaction time of about 200ms for the machine control and then activated the safety switching
outputs for the closing movement (OSSDs). The OSSDs remain activated as long as the AKAS® receives a
slow speed message to SGS and SGO within the next 70 ms + the selected enhanced tolerance. A tolderance en-
hancement is possible only with the AKAS® .....F systems .
In the case of bending of very small pieces, which must be guided by the finger
s
, the box-bending function
must be selected. Otherwise, the fingers would interrupt E1 (AKAS ® -IIM/-F and AKAS -LCM/-LCF ®), or
E3, E4, E5, E6 (AKAS -3M/-F ®), which would lead to the switching off of the bending process !
With activated box-bending function, a finger which is placed next to the slog on a large matrix, is not
detected!!
